An Italian restaurant on the outskirts of Greater Manchester has been named the best in England - just five years after being taken over.
On Sunday night (November 17), Giuliano, based in Handforth, Cheshire, was named the Best Restaurant in England at the renowned England Business Awards, which were held in Birmingham.
Competing amongst ten regional finalists, the Wilmslow Road eatery was praised for its authentic selection of meals, drawing inspiration from Sicily, featuring stone-baked pizzas, pastas and meat and fish dishes.
